Why Manual Testing Is Vital in QA's Evolving Landscape
As digital transformation accelerates, the role of manual testing continues to adapt. While automation expedites repetitive tasks, manual testing excels in areas requiring human intuition, exploration, and emotional intelligence. By 2025, manual testing will evolve even further:
1. Exploratory Testing
Performing exploratory testing will remain vital. This method helps uncover unpredictable issues that automated systems fail to anticipate, ensuring robust software quality.
2. UX Validation
Assessing usability and user experience involves human insights that automation cannot replicate. Manual testers ensure applications are user-friendly, intuitive, and engaging.
3. Bridging Automation and Real-World Scenarios
Manual testing complements automation by aligning automated scenarios with actual user behaviors, integrating cultural sensitivities and accessibility standards.
4. AI Validation
Evaluating AI-driven systems is becoming an essential skill. Manual testers will assess AI for ethical concerns, preventing bias and unintended outcomes.
Critical Skills for Manual Testers in 2025
To remain competitive, QA professionals must cultivate skills that align with future trends in software testing:
1. Critical Thinking
Manual testers must think beyond predefined scenarios to uncover edge cases. Analytical and investigative mindsets will be key.
2. Technical Proficiency
Understanding databases, APIs, and basic automation frameworks will enhance collaboration with developers and automation specialists.
3. AI Knowledge
Familiarity with tools like Zof AI is essential. Learn how to leverage AI for efficient testing workflows and enhanced outcomes.
4. Domain Expertise
In-depth knowledge of your industry—gaming, healthcare, finance, etc.—enables targeted manual testing tailored to specific user needs.
5. Soft Skills
Empathy, adaptability, and communication will distinguish exceptional manual testers. These traits humanize QA processes.
6. Data Analysis
QA professionals must interpret data from logs and automation tools, generating actionable insights to improve products.
Manual Testing Strategies for a Hybrid Model
Balancing automation and manual testing is essential for future QA workflows. Adopt these strategies to create a seamless hybrid model:
1. Collaborative Design
Work closely with automation engineers to create complementary test scenarios.
2. Empowerment Through AI
Use AI tools like Zof AI to assist manual workflows. Zof AI enhances efficiency by generating smarter test cases and identifying high-risk areas.
3. Hybrid Testing Models
Combine automation for repetitive tasks with manual testing for exploratory, usability, and accessibility validations.
4. Continuous Monitoring
Leverage real-time feedback in CI/CD pipelines to identify unexpected issues during production.
5. Usability Testing Priority
Prioritize usability testing for applications by focusing on areas automation often overlooks.
